A Roman Diva Faustina sestertius struck in Rome. Faustina, the wife of Antoninus Pius, died in 140 AD and was deified in 141 AD, so this coin dates to 141 AD at the earliest. It is inscribed AVGVSTA on the reverse and depicts Ceres standing facing left holding two torches. The coin is worn and weighs 18.62g.

A 2nd-century Roman silver denarius of Antoninus Pius as Caesar (under Hadrian) which can be dated to 138AD, specifically between 25 February and 10 July. The earlier date was the day of Antoninus Pius' adoption and the later date the day on which his adopter Hadrian died.
